Latest Patents

Aonuma's latest patents include groundbreaking designs that enhance vehicle safety and performance. One of his notable inventions is a frame structure of a vehicle, which features a front side frame and a reinforcing member within a closed cross section. This design incorporates an inner bead portion with ridgelines that project inwardly, improving the structural integrity of the vehicle. Another significant patent is for a side body structure of a vehicle, which includes a hinge pillar and side sill that form closed section spaces. This innovative design enhances the vehicle's overall strength and safety.
